Named in the 1897 county history
The history of Essex County was published 43 years before the first of these atlases, and it names this establishment.
Another interesting fact in connection with the Saugus postal administration is that when the aviation park was in its heyday of threatened success at the Old Saugus Race Track, mail for two or three days was sent by flying machine to the Lynn boundary, where it was dropped to waiting messengers, and by them carried to the Lynn Post Office from a point not far from the foot of Commercial Street, West Lynn, and thence dispatched to the addresses, wherever they might be. Such a letter was dispatched to the late Hon. Curtis Guild, Jr., at the time United States Ambassador at St. Petersburg (now Petrograd), Russia, who courteously acknowledged its receipt, with complimentary references to the unique manner in which it had been dispatched from Saugus.
